Erling Haaland to miss Norway’s Euro 2024 qualifiers with groin injury

New Delhi, March 21 : Striker Erling Haaland has pulled out of the Norway squad for their Euro 2024 qualifiers matches against Spain and Georgia after sustaining a groin injury, the countrys football association said on Tuesday.

The Manchester City striker picked up a groin problem after scoring a hat-trick in Citys 6-0 thrashing of Burnley in the FA Cup quarterfinal on Saturday.

"We hoped that this was just a familiarity that would carry over to Saturday, but after doing tests and examinations yesterday it became clear that he will not make it to the games against Spain and Georgia.It is better that he receives medical follow-up at the club," Norways national team doctor Ola Sand said in a statement.

Norway was drawn in group A alongside Cyprus, Georgia, Scotland and Spain.Stale Solbakkens side first plays Spain on March 26 at the La Rosaleda Stadium.

They will then take on Georgia on March 28 at Adjarabet Arena.The 22-year-old striker has scored 21 goals in 23 appearances for Norway since making his debut in September 2019.
